Sometimes substances such as penicillin, peanut butter, bacteria, eggs, and other items will provoke an immune response. They ha

ve ________________ that will mount a response from the immune system.
Medicine
2 answers:
irina [24]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

Allergens

Explanation:

The immune system of the body helps to fight against the harmful pathogens and protect our body. The different immune cells present in the body are macrophages, monocytes, T cells and B cells.

The immune reaction might occur in the body due to the encounter of the antigen and antibody. Antigen may be defined as any substance that are treated as foreign substance for the body and antibodies are produced in the body to kill that antigen. The peanut butter, eggs sometimes contain the substance that might acts as allergen and generate immune response. The allergen substance evokes the immune reaction in the body.

Thus, the answer is allergen.

Heart sounds are caused when the valves close during a normal cardiac cycle. Murmurs can be caused by turbulent blood flow throu
Furkat [3]

Mitral regurgitation is a leakage of blood that flows backward via the mitral valve during contraction of the left ventricle which results in systolic murmur.

<u>Explanation:</u>

Mitral valve is seen between the left atrium and left ventricle,it prevents the back flow of blood during left ventricular contraction. In case of mitral valve regurgitation or stenosis condition it results in back flow of blood to left atrium it further results in increased blood pressure in left atrium and fluid buildup in lungs and leads to systolic murmur. During cardiac cycle systole occurs when heart contracts and diastole occurs when heart relaxes.
